"A lawyer who manages the affairs of someone who is incompetent or incapable of making decisions on his or her own behalf. Conservatorships are granted by a court to a conservator for an individual, called a conservatee, who is Gravely disabled. "

"A guardian ad litem is a unique type of guardian in a relationship that has been called a `hybrid' of the classic guardianship relationship. ... The traditional `guardian' represents the ward and owes a duty of loyalty to the ward."
